Greenwich is a charming and historic area of London, renowned for giving its name to Greenwich Mean Time, the standard by which British clocks are set. This vibrant borough is home to several notable attractions, including the Cutty Sark, a historic clipper ship, and the Maritime Museum, which offers fascinating insights into Britain’s seafaring heritage. Visitors can enjoy the unique atmosphere of Greenwich, exploring its streets, learning about its history, and experiencing the maritime culture that has shaped this iconic area of London.

A highlight of Greenwich is the Greenwich Meridian, an imaginary line representing 0° longitude that passes through the borough and extends from the North Pole to the South Pole. This meridian forms the basis for the world’s standard time zone system and provides a unique opportunity for visitors to stand on the line dividing the eastern and western hemispheres. Another must-see attraction is the Cutty Sark, the world’s only surviving extreme clipper ship, which exemplifies the pinnacle of 19th-century ship design and was celebrated as one of the fastest ships of its time. Touring these sites offers a fascinating glimpse into history, navigation, and maritime innovation.
